ComCat is a Resharper plugin that helps with 2 things in C# programming:
- Order DataMembers of DataContract
- Synchronize method / proprty XML doc comments between interface / base class and implementation.
#Installation You will need Resharper (8.2.1+ but no higher than 9.0) installed. Then use the Resharper extensions manager to find and install this plugin
#Usage
- To Order DataMembers, open the DataContract class, make sure the caret is on the class name, a context action should appear with name "Reorder DataMember in this class", click it and a pop-up window will help take care of business.
- To Sync comments, open the implementation class file, make sure the caret is either on the class name, or on a XML document comment block (won't work with other comment types) for any inheriting method / property, 2 context actions should appear with names "Take comments from base class" and "Push comments to base class". Note this will not work from the interface.
